Legendary Australian rock band, Cold Chisel has announced they will headline the inaugural Coates Hire Newcastle 500 on 25 November.
Renowned as one of the most dynamic Australian live acts ever, Cold Chisel – Jimmy Barnes (lead vocals), Ian Moss (lead guitar/vocals), Don Walker (keyboards / backing vocals), Phil Small (bass guitar) and Charley Drayton (drums) – will perform their iconic hits such as Flame Trees, Khe Sanh, Cheap Wine, Rising Sun and Bow River, as well as songs from their recent albums ‘No Plans’ and ‘The Perfect Crime’.
NSW Minister for Tourism and Major Events Adam Marshall said, “Cold Chisel are Australian rock royalty as well as racing enthusiasts, which makes them the perfect fit to headline the inaugural Coates Hire Newcastle 500. I encourage motorsport and music fans alike to get their tickets now for what promises to be an excellent weekend of racing and entertainment.”
The Coates Hires Newcastle 500 has been secured for Newcastle by Destination NSW, with the support of Newcastle City Council.
